ARTICLE I

ONE HUNDRED SECOND SERIES BONDS

SECTION 1 There shall be a series of bonds designated “5.35% Series due March 15, 2034” (herein sometimes called the “One Hundred Second Series”), each of which shall also bear the descriptive title “First Mortgage Bond,” and the form thereof, which has been established by Resolution of the Board of Directors of the Company, is attached hereto as Exhibit A. Bonds of the One Hundred Second Series (which shall be issued initially in the aggregate principal amount of $500,000,000) shall be dated as in Section 10 of the Mortgage provided, shall mature on March 15, 2034, shall be issued as fully registered bonds in any integral multiple or multiples of One Thousand Dollars, and shall bear interest at the rate of 5.35% per annum, the first interest payment to be made on September 15, 2024, for the period from March 8, 2024 to September 15, 2024 with subsequent interest payments payable semiannually on March 15 and September 15 of each year

 

14


(each, for purposes of this Article I, an “Interest Payment Date”), the principal of and interest on each said bond to be payable at the office or agency of the Company in the Borough of Manhattan, The City of New York, in such coin or currency of the United States of America as at the time of payment is legal tender for public and private debts. Interest on the bonds of the One Hundred Second Series shall be paid to the Person in whose name such bonds of the One Hundred Second Series are registered.

Interest on the bonds of the One Hundred Second Series will be computed on the basis of a 360-day year of twelve 30-day months. In any case where any Interest Payment Date, redemption date or the maturity date of any bond of the One Hundred Second Series shall not be a Business Day, then payment of interest or principal and premium, if any, need not be made on such date, but may be made on the next succeeding Business Day, with the same force and effect, and in the same amount, as if made on the corresponding Interest Payment Date, redemption date, or at maturity, as the case may be, and, if such payment is made or duly provided for on such Business Day, no interest shall accrue on the amount so payable for the period from and after such Interest Payment Date, redemption date or the maturity date, as the case may be, to such Business Day. “Business Day” means any day, other than a Saturday or a Sunday, or a day on which banking institutions in The City of New York are authorized or required by law or executive order to remain closed or a day on which the corporate trust office of the Trustee is closed for business.

The bonds of the One Hundred Second Series shall be issued by the Company, registered in the name of and delivered to The Bank of New York Mellon, as trustee (together with its successors as trustee under the Collateral Trust Mortgage referenced below, the “Collateral Trust Trustee”) under the Mortgage and Deed of Trust of the Company dated as of November 1, 2015 as the same may be supplemented and amended from time to time (the “Collateral Trust Mortgage”), to provide for the payment when due (whether at maturity, by acceleration or otherwise) of the principal and interest of the Securities (as defined in the Collateral Trust Mortgage) to be issued from time to time under the Collateral Trust Mortgage.

Any payment by the Company under the Collateral Trust Mortgage of the principal of or interest on the Securities which shall have been authenticated and delivered under the Collateral Trust Mortgage on the basis of the issuance and delivery to the Collateral Trust Trustee of bonds of the One Hundred Second Series (other than by application of the proceeds of a payment in respect of such bonds) shall, to the extent of such payment, be deemed to satisfy and discharge the obligation of the Company, if any, to make a payment of principal of, or interest on such bonds, as the case may be, which is then due.

The Trustee may conclusively presume that the obligation of the Company to pay the principal of and interest on the bonds of the One Hundred Second Series as the same shall become due and payable shall have been fully satisfied and discharged unless and until it shall have received a written notice from the Collateral Trust Trustee signed by its President, a Vice President, an Assistant Vice President or a Trust Officer, stating that interest or principal due and payable on any Securities issued under the Collateral Trust Mortgage has not been fully paid and specifying the amount of funds required to make such payment.

 

15


(I) Each holder of a bond of the One Hundred Second Series consents that the bonds of the One Hundred Second Series may be redeemed at the option of the Company or pursuant to the requirements of the Mortgage in whole at any time, or in part from time to time, prior to maturity, without notice provided in Section 52 of the Mortgage, at the principal amount of the bonds to be redeemed, in each case, together with accrued interest to the date fixed for redemption by the Company in a notice delivered to the Trustee and to the holder of the bonds to be redeemed on or before the date fixed for redemption.

The bonds of the One Hundred Second Series shall be redeemed, in whole at any time, or in part from time to time, prior to maturity, at a redemption price equal to the principal amount thereof, upon receipt by the Trustee of a written notice from the Collateral Trust Trustee (i) delivered to the Trustee and the Company, (ii) signed by its President, a Vice President, an Assistant Vice President or a Trust Officer, (iii) stating that an Event of Default has occurred and is continuing under the Collateral Trust Mortgage and that, as a result, there then is due and payable a specified amount with respect to the Securities Outstanding under the Collateral Trust Mortgage, for the payment of which the Collateral Trust Trustee has not received funds, and (iv) specifying the principal amount of the bonds of the One Hundred Second Series to be redeemed. Delivery of such notice shall constitute a waiver by the Collateral Trust Trustee of notice of redemption under the Mortgage.

(II) The bonds of the One Hundred Second Series shall not be transferable by the Collateral Trust Trustee, except to a successor trustee under the Collateral Trust Mortgage. Bonds of this series so transferable to a successor trustee under the Collateral Trust Mortgage may be transferred by the registered owner thereof, in person, or by his duly authorized attorney, at the office or agency of the Company in the Borough of Manhattan, The City of New York, in the manner prescribed in the Mortgage.

At the option of the registered owner, any bonds of the One Hundred Second Series, upon surrender thereof for cancellation at the office or agency of the Company in the Borough of Manhattan, The City of New York, shall be exchangeable for a like aggregate principal amount of bonds of the One Hundred Second Series of other authorized denominations.

Upon any exchange or transfer of bonds of the One Hundred Second Series, the Company may make a charge therefor sufficient to reimburse it for any tax or taxes or other governmental charge, as provided in Section 12 of the Mortgage, but the Company hereby waives any right to make a charge in addition thereto for any exchange or transfer of bonds of said Series.

(III) Upon the delivery of this Ninety-eighth Supplemental Indenture and upon compliance with the applicable provisions of the Mortgage, as heretofore supplemented, there shall be an initial issue of bonds of the One Hundred Second Series in the aggregate principal amount of $500,000,000. Additional bonds of the One Hundred Second Series, without limitation as to

 

16


amount, having substantially the same terms as the Outstanding bonds of the One Hundred Second Series (except for the issue date and, if applicable, the initial Interest Payment Date) may be issued by the Company, subject to satisfaction of the requirements of the Mortgage, as heretofore supplemented, without notice to or the consent of the existing holders of the bonds of the One Hundred Second Series.

ARTICLE II

ONE HUNDRED THIRD SERIES BONDS

SECTION 1 There shall be a series of bonds designated “5.70% Series due March 15, 2054” (herein sometimes called the “One Hundred Third Series”), each of which shall also bear the descriptive title “First Mortgage Bond,” and the form thereof, which has been established by Resolution of the Board of Directors of the Company, is attached hereto as Exhibit B. Bonds of the One Hundred Third Series (which shall be issued initially in the aggregate principal amount of $700,000,000) shall be dated as in Section 10 of the Mortgage provided, shall mature on March 15, 2054, shall be issued as fully registered bonds in any integral multiple or multiples of One Thousand Dollars, and shall bear interest at the rate of 5.70% per annum, the first interest payment to be made on September 15, 2024, for the period from March 8, 2024 to September 15, 2024 with subsequent interest payments payable semiannually on March 15 and September 15 of each year (each, for purposes of this Article II, an “Interest Payment Date”), the principal of and interest on each said bond to be payable at the office or agency of the Company in the Borough of Manhattan, The City of New York, in such coin or currency of the United States of America as at the time of payment is legal tender for public and private debts. Interest on the bonds of the One Hundred Third Series shall be paid to the Person in whose name such bonds of the One Hundred Third Series are registered.

Interest on the bonds of the One Hundred Third Series will be computed on the basis of a 360-day year of twelve 30-day months. In any case where any Interest Payment Date, redemption date or the maturity date of any bond of the One Hundred Third Series shall not be a Business Day, then payment of interest or principal and premium, if any, need not be made on such date, but may be made on the next succeeding Business Day, with the same force and effect, and in the same amount, as if made on the corresponding Interest Payment Date, redemption date, or at maturity, as the case may be, and, if such payment is made or duly provided for on such Business Day, no interest shall accrue on the amount so payable for the period from and after such Interest Payment Date, redemption date or the maturity date, as the case may be, to such Business Day.

The bonds of the One Hundred Third Series shall be issued by the Company, registered in the name of and delivered to the Collateral Trust Trustee, to provide for the payment when due (whether at maturity, by acceleration or otherwise) of the principal and interest of the Securities to be issued from time to time under the Collateral Trust Mortgage.

 

17


Any payment by the Company under the Collateral Trust Mortgage of the principal of or interest on the Securities which shall have been authenticated and delivered under the Collateral Trust Mortgage on the basis of the issuance and delivery to the Collateral Trust Trustee of bonds of the One Hundred Third Series (other than by application of the proceeds of a payment in respect of such bonds) shall, to the extent of such payment, be deemed to satisfy and discharge the obligation of the Company, if any, to make a payment of principal of, or interest on such bonds, as the case may be, which is then due.

The Trustee may conclusively presume that the obligation of the Company to pay the principal of and interest on the bonds of the One Hundred Third Series as the same shall become due and payable shall have been fully satisfied and discharged unless and until it shall have received a written notice from the Collateral Trust Trustee signed by its President, a Vice President, an Assistant Vice President or a Trust Officer, stating that interest or principal due and payable on any Securities issued under the Collateral Trust Mortgage has not been fully paid and specifying the amount of funds required to make such payment.

(I) Each holder of a bond of the One Hundred Third Series consents that the bonds of the One Hundred Third Series may be redeemed at the option of the Company or pursuant to the requirements of the Mortgage in whole at any time, or in part from time to time, prior to maturity, without notice provided in Section 52 of the Mortgage, at the principal amount of the bonds to be redeemed, in each case, together with accrued interest to the date fixed for redemption by the Company in a notice delivered to the Trustee and to the holder of the bonds to be redeemed on or before the date fixed for redemption.

The bonds of the One Hundred Third Series shall be redeemed, in whole at any time, or in part from time to time, prior to maturity, at a redemption price equal to the principal amount thereof, upon receipt by the Trustee of a written notice from the Collateral Trust Trustee (i) delivered to the Trustee and the Company, (ii) signed by its President, a Vice President, an Assistant Vice President or a Trust Officer, (iii) stating that an Event of Default has occurred and is continuing under the Collateral Trust Mortgage and that, as a result, there then is due and payable a specified amount with respect to the Securities Outstanding under the Collateral Trust Mortgage, for the payment of which the Collateral Trust Trustee has not received funds, and (iv) specifying the principal amount of the bonds of the One Hundred Third Series to be redeemed. Delivery of such notice shall constitute a waiver by the Collateral Trust Trustee of notice of redemption under the Mortgage.

(II) The bonds of the One Hundred Third Series shall not be transferable by the Collateral Trust Trustee, except to a successor trustee under the Collateral Trust Mortgage. Bonds of this series so transferable to a successor trustee under the Collateral Trust Mortgage may be transferred by the registered owner thereof, in person, or by his duly authorized attorney, at the office or agency of the Company in the Borough of Manhattan, The City of New York, in the manner prescribed in the Mortgage.

 

18


At the option of the registered owner, any bonds of the One Hundred Third Series, upon surrender thereof for cancellation at the office or agency of the Company in the Borough of Manhattan, The City of New York, shall be exchangeable for a like aggregate principal amount of bonds of the One Hundred Third Series of other authorized denominations.

Upon any exchange or transfer of bonds of the One Hundred Third Series, the Company may make a charge therefor sufficient to reimburse it for any tax or taxes or other governmental charge, as provided in Section 12 of the Mortgage, but the Company hereby waives any right to make a charge in addition thereto for any exchange or transfer of bonds of said Series.

(III) Upon the delivery of this Ninety-eighth Supplemental Indenture and upon compliance with the applicable provisions of the Mortgage, as heretofore supplemented, there shall be an initial issue of bonds of the One Hundred Third Series in the aggregate principal amount of $700,000,000. Additional bonds of the One Hundred Third Series, without limitation as to amount, having substantially the same terms as the Outstanding bonds of the One Hundred Third Series (except for the issue date and, if applicable, the initial Interest Payment Date) may be issued by the Company, subject to satisfaction of the requirements of the Mortgage, as heretofore supplemented, without notice to or the consent of the existing holders of the bonds of the One Hundred Third Series.
